Biography - Fiona C McEvoy


Dr. Fiona McEvoy is excited to be a part of the APUS team. She has an undergraduate degree in Early Childhood and Elementary Education, an M.S. in School Counseling and Psychology, and a doctorate in Teacher Leadership. She has worked in public schools since 1998 and is currently a full-time elementary school counselor.
